Jon's Current Read

Lofton Oaks is a settled Yulee community of 74 homes built between 1994 and 2022, though the median build year of 1995 tells you most of the stock is original to the neighborhood's first wave. With a median just over 1,500 square feet, this is a modestly scaled market where price is driven less by size and more by condition — updated kitchens, roofs, and systems separate the sellers who move quickly from those who sit.

An owner-occupancy share of roughly 81% points to a stable, held-long-term community rather than an investor churn. For sellers, that scarcity of turnover can work in your favor when your home shows well. For buyers, it means inventory is thin and condition varies widely, so be ready to move on the right listing and to underwrite renovation costs on the ones that need work.

The market around Lofton Oaks

Lofton Oaks is too small for its own price trend, so here is the market around it.

In ZIP 32097, 276 homes are on the market and 31% are under contract — a fast-moving corner of Yulee.

Across Nassau County, 518 homes are active and 209 pending (29% under contract).

ZIP and county figures describe the wider market, not Lofton Oaks specifically. Momentum Research analysis of MLS records.

A condition-driven resale market

The spread here is defined by age and upkeep. With original construction dating to the mid-1990s and a handful of newer homes stretching to 2022, buyers will encounter everything from untouched originals to fully reworked interiors within the same 74-home community. Because the homes are similarly sized, the pricing conversation almost always comes down to what has been replaced and when — roof, HVAC, and kitchen carry disproportionate weight in a market this consistent in square footage.

The high homestead share reshapes the transaction cadence. Homes don't come up often, and when they do, well-maintained ones tend to draw attention because comparable move-in-ready options are limited. That same dynamic can frustrate buyers hunting for a bargain: the discounts are usually in homes that need work, and the renovation math has to pencil out before you chase one.
